Abstract

The invention relates to a multi-user visible light communication method and a multi-user visible light communication system. The method comprises the steps of generating a plurality of chaotic sequences for identifying different users in a multi-user visible light communication system; performing CSK modulation on bit information input by each user of a transmitting end, thus obtaining a three-dimensional transmission vector, including RGB information, corresponding to each user; modulating the transmission vectors for the second time by using the chaotic sequences corresponding to the users, thus obtaining transmission matrixes corresponding to the users, and transmitting the transmission matrixes to a receiving end via an optical wireless channel; receiving the matrixes transmitted by the optical wireless channel by the receiving end, demodulating the matrixes by using the chaotic sequences corresponding to the users, thus obtaining the three-dimensional transmission vectors, including RGB information, corresponding to the users; and demodulating each three-dimensional transmission vector to obtain the bit information transmitted by the corresponding user. According to the multi-user visible light communication method, the interference among users can be reduced, the reliability and security of the system can be improved, and the system capacity can be increased.

Description

technical field [0001] The present invention relates to the technical field of optical communication, in particular to a multi-user visible light communication method and a multi-user visible light communication system. Background technique [0002] Visible Light Communication (VisibleLightCommunication, VLC) technology uses light emitting diodes (LightEmittingDiode, LED) instead of traditional wireless antennas to transmit data, can realize lighting and communication at the same time, and can use the visible spectrum without authorization, which can solve the spectrum resources of traditional wireless communication systems shortage problem. [0003] Color shift keying (Colour Shift Keying, CSK) is a modulation technology suitable for visible light communication systems. In CSK technology, the transmission rate is increased by modulating the input bits into the CIE1931 color space, and then transmitting different information through different colors.
